Important Details on Ayodhya Ram Mandir Aarti Pass Booking 2025

Booking for Aarti passes started before the Shri Ram Lalla1s Abhishek ceremony on 22 January. At the Ram Janmabhoomi Mandir, three Aartis take place every day: Shringar Aarti in the morning, Bhog Aarti during noon, and Sandhya Aarti in the evening. Only devotees holding a valid Aarti pass can attend these ceremonies. Each Aarti allows up to 30 devotees to join to keep security in place. Currently, the number is limited, but it could increase based on demand. This service is completely free and equal for everyone, whether rich or poor, young or old.

Timings of Aarti at Ram Mandir

  • Morning Shringar Aarti: 6:30 AM
  • Bhog Aarti: 12:00 PM (Noon)
  • Evening Sandhya Aarti: 7:30 PM

Pran Pratishtha Ceremony Duration

Pran Pratishtha ceremonies will take place from 16 January to 22 January. Lord Ram Lalla will be placed in the new temple during these seven days of rituals. The installation will be done by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on 22 January. Before the ceremony, Ram Lalla will be bathed with Sarayu river water, will take a tour around the Panchkosi area of Ramnagar, and visit other temples in Ayodhya.

Schedule of Pran Pratishtha Program

  • 16 January – Ritual of repentance by appointed priests
  • 16 January – Ten types of holy baths at Sarayu riverbank
  • 16 January – Vishnu Puja and donation ceremonies
  • 17 January – Grand procession with Ram Lalla’s idol around Ayodhya
  • 17 January – Devotees bring holy water from Sarayu in ceremonial pots
  • 18 January – Puja rituals to Lord Ganesh, Ambika, Varun, and mother goddesses
  • 18 January – Brahmin welcoming and Vastu Shanti rituals begin
  • 19 January – Fire altar installation, Navagraha installation, and Havan
  • 20 January – Temple sanctum cleansed with Sarayu water followed by Vastu Shanti and Annadhivas
  • 21 January – Divine bath with 125 kalash followed by Shaiyadhivas
  • 22 January – Morning puja followed by Ram Lalla idol installation during Mrigashirsha Nakshatra

How to Book Ayodhya Ram Mandir Aarti Pass Online?

Follow these simple steps to book your Aarti pass online:

  • Go to the official Shri Ram Janmabhoomi Teerth Kshetra website: https://srjbtkshetra.org/
  • On the homepage, click on the button “Click here to Reserve your Passes”.
  • A new page will open with important instructions; read them carefully.
  • Fill in the required details like date of Aarti, type of Aarti (Shringar, Bhog, or Sandhya), and number of devotees.
  • Click on “Proceed” to finish your booking.

How to Get Aarti Pass Offline?

To get the Aarti pass offline, visit the counters near the Ram Mandir. Show any one of the valid government ID proofs (Aadhaar, Passport, Driving License, or Voter ID) and book your pass. Only devotees with a valid pass will be allowed inside for Aarti. Carry a copy of the ID you used for booking with you when you visit.
